Haval H6: The Haval H6 combines the strengths of seven other models, offering style, space, power, a sense of luxury, and cost-effectiveness, meeting consumer demands for family cars. 2. Haval H9: A mid-to-large SUV, the Haval H9 is a genuine off-road family SUV with options for 5 or 7 seats, priced around 250,000 to 260,000 yuan. The Haval H9 excels in comfort, configuration, and noise insulation, with ample space, making it perfectly suitable as a family car. It features a ladder-frame chassis, front and rear mechanical differential locks, a solid rear axle, and over 380 Nm of torque, comparable to pure off-road vehicles. 3. Haval F5: The Haval H5 is a compact SUV primarily targeting young consumers. Its biggest advantage is its excellent cost-effectiveness, and its exterior design appeals to young people. However, this car is not ideal for purely family use due to its limited space, making it more suitable as a commuter vehicle.

After driving the Haval F7, I believe fuel consumption depends on engine tuning. The 1.5GDIT turbocharged version has a combined fuel consumption of 8.7 liters, which is quite reasonable; older models like the 2.0L can reach 11 liters in urban areas. Direct injection technology and lightweight design help reduce fuel consumption, and newer models like the Haval First Love are more fuel-efficient. Vehicle weight has a significant impact, with SUVs consuming 1-2 liters more than sedans. Driving with windows closed and maintaining a steady speed on highways saves fuel, as it reduces wind resistance. Regularly cleaning the throttle body also contributes to better fuel economy.
